 So our day started super early as the bus left at 5am so after a 15 min walk with our bags we got on the bus .

This route is a major pain as you have to leave Argentina then enter Chile then re-enter Argentina again due to it being the only road north which means customs and immigration at each stop. This involved us getting off the bus 4 separate times some of which involved getting out backpacks of to get scanned too and waiting in long lines while everyone gets their passports stamped.  

Next up we had to get off again to get on a boat for 10 mins to cross to the next bit of road - I had heard from other people that you often see dolphins here and these being Marc's favourite animal we stood looking out at the calm sea in hope. We were half way across when I spotted one, then another and another, they were literally chasing the boat jumping out f the water loads, they were small black and white ones that are only found in Patagonia. Typically though I got a couple of shots and the camera battery died but there is a few second video clip of them below . It was amazing there were so many and so close to the boat - Marc was well chuffed.

We eventually got to Rio Gallegos at 4pm where we had to change bus and had 3 hours to wait, it was cold and to top it off there was literally nothing to do it was just the bus station and a supermarket no bar nothing. So we went for some sandwiches for dinner and waited.

We get on the next bus for the last 4 hours of the trip, we were treated to an amazing sunset the sky was all colours of orange and purple it was stunning (no camera). We finally arrived around 1am the hostel guy had come to meet us as there was a few of us we then had a 10 min walk uphill to the hostel...we are so unfit.

 
El Calafte 
People only really come here for one thing, the Perito Moreno glacier there isn't really much else to do. Its a pretty little town with an amazing view of the lake which is so blue, we could see this from our room it was lovely .

Costs
Bus from Ushuaia - El Calafate £100 each
Cost of bed in 4 bed dorm - £12 each
